The Evolution of Digital Music Consumption

Digital music has dramatically shifted from individual track downloads, pioneered by iTunes, to subscription-based streaming services, fundamentally changing how people access and pay for music.

The top 3

  1. Top 3 Global Music Streaming Services by Subscribers: Spotify, Apple Music, and Amazon Music consistently rank as the top three music streaming services worldwide by subscriber numbers, with Spotify leading with 31.4% of paid subscribers globally as of end-2025.
  2. Most Popular Music Consumption Methods Today: Streaming services account for over 50% of all music consumption, with subscription music streaming (23%) and video music streaming (22%) being the most popular, followed by purchased music (9%) and social media (3%) as of August 2023.
  3. Top 3 Revenue Streams for the Global Music Industry: Streaming, especially paid subscriptions, is the dominant revenue stream for the global recorded music industry, accounting for close to 70% of total income in 2025, followed by physical formats (16.6%) and performance rights (just under 10%).
